Structured Entity Tax Credit - The irs transfer pricing is attacking an inventive scheme involving state conservation tax loans. The strategy works by having people set up partnerships that invest in state conservation credits. The credits are eventually dried-up and a K-1 is distributed to the partners who then consider the credits on your personal yield. The IRS is arguing that you cannot find any legitimate business purpose for the partnership, which makes the strategy fraudulent.
